Output 886a88a40ddfdf3280511acc487830e8a2ccede14e608222bfff8967ca96940c:1

value
540713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5121e39c43787bad1adc337afb7a6d22cf2a1f OP_EQUAL
address
3HDZzLBJdX3MnsJPgtJQzjH26Z74M6Lr2E
transaction
886a88a40ddfdf3280511acc487830e8a2ccede14e608222bfff8967ca96940c
spent
true